What is a DPS Profile?

The DPS sound enhancer uses a system of “Profiles” which contain settings that optimize audio for a specific device or a range of devices. Each device, whether it is your built-in speaker, your iPod dock, or your earbuds have very different audio capabilities. The DPS technology uses information in the profile to re-master audio in real-time to suit your listening device.  Each profile is created by hand by Bongiovi Acoustics audio engineers who have years of experience recording music and making the movie soundtracks you enjoy.  We do the hard audio work so you don't have to!

Why City Profiles?

We understand you may have a listening device that is not in the default profile list or on the Bongiovi Acoustics website.  That is why we created the City profiles so you may take the DPS Road Trip.  Each City profile works very well on a wide range of devices including all types of headphones or earbuds as well as iPod docks and mobile speakers.  Try them all...your ears will know which one to call home.  Listening to music is a personal emotional experience.  You know you have chosen the right profile when that experience is better for YOU!
